Analysis

In 2024, closed shrubland — emissions in Zambia stood at 0.0228 kt.

The figure is down 3.0% on the previous year and down 74.9% over ten years.

Over the whole period, closed shrubland — emissions in Zambia peaked at 0.8641 kt in 1998 and was at its lowest, 0.0197 kt, in 2022.

Zambia ranks 11th of 219 countries on this measure, in the top 10%.

The series is highly variable year to year, so single readings are best treated with caution.

The FAOSTAT domain on Emissions from Fires consists of estimates of methane (CH4), nitrous oxide (N2O) and carbon dioxide (CO2) emissions generated from biomass burning in a range of vegetation types and from fires in organic soils.
